What is retail ERP implementation governance for merchandising and supply coordination?
Retail ERP implementation governance is the operating model that defines who makes decisions, how priorities are set, what standards guide design, and how risks are controlled across merchandising and supply functions. In retail, governance matters because assortment planning, purchasing, replenishment, inventory visibility, promotions, finance, ecommerce, and store operations are tightly connected. If each function optimizes independently, the ERP program can deliver technical completion without business alignment. Effective governance creates one decision framework for process design, data ownership, integration sequencing, release control, and adoption accountability.
Why do merchandising and supply teams need a shared governance model?
They need a shared model because most retail execution failures happen at the handoff points between planning and fulfillment. Merchandising may define item hierarchies, vendor terms, and assortment logic, while supply teams manage lead times, replenishment rules, allocation, and inventory movement. If those decisions are made in separate forums, the ERP design can produce conflicting master data, duplicate workflows, and poor exception handling. Shared governance aligns commercial intent with operational feasibility, which improves forecast quality, inventory turns, margin protection, and service levels.

Who should own decisions in a retail ERP governance structure?
Decision ownership should be distributed by business accountability, not by system access or project hierarchy alone. Executive sponsors should own strategic outcomes such as margin improvement, inventory productivity, and operating model standardization. A PMO or program management office should own cadence, escalation, dependency management, and reporting. Process owners from merchandising, supply chain, finance, stores, and digital commerce should own future-state decisions. Enterprise architecture should own integration principles, security standards, and environment strategy. Implementation partners should advise, document trade-offs, and execute within approved governance boundaries rather than becoming the de facto decision makers.
| Governance Layer | Primary Responsibility |
|---|---|
| Executive Steering Committee | Approve scope, funding, policy decisions, and cross-functional trade-offs |
| PMO or Program Office | Manage plan, risks, dependencies, issue escalation, and delivery controls |
| Business Design Authority | Approve process design, role ownership, and operating model standards |
| Architecture and Data Governance | Control integrations, master data standards, security, and technical quality |
| Workstream Leads | Execute configuration, testing, training, migration, and readiness activities |
How should discovery and assessment be structured before design begins?
Discovery should establish business truth before solution assumptions harden. For retail programs, that means documenting current merchandising calendars, item lifecycle processes, supplier onboarding, purchase order controls, allocation logic, replenishment triggers, returns handling, and channel-specific fulfillment rules. Assessment should also identify where local practices are strategic versus where they are simply historical workarounds. A strong discovery phase maps process pain points to measurable business outcomes, inventories source systems and interfaces, evaluates data quality, and identifies policy conflicts such as pricing authority, markdown governance, or inventory ownership across channels.
This phase is also where implementation leaders should classify complexity. Examples include seasonal assortment volatility, franchise or concession models, drop-ship dependencies, warehouse management integration, and regional tax or compliance requirements. The goal is not to document everything equally. The goal is to identify which decisions will materially affect architecture, migration, testing, and adoption.
How do teams align business process analysis with solution design?
Alignment happens when process analysis is treated as a design discipline rather than a documentation exercise. Teams should define future-state workflows around decision quality, control points, and exception management. For example, item creation should not only capture attributes for merchandising; it should also support replenishment logic, financial posting, ecommerce syndication, and reporting. Purchase order workflows should reflect approval thresholds, supplier collaboration, and receiving realities. Replenishment design should account for store clustering, lead times, safety stock, and promotional demand signals.
A practical rule is to standardize where scale matters and localize only where business value is clear. Excessive customization often protects legacy habits rather than competitive differentiation. Governance should require each requested deviation to state the business rationale, operational impact, support implications, and measurable benefit.
What architecture principles reduce risk in retail ERP programs?
The safest architecture is one that keeps core ERP responsibilities clear and limits unnecessary coupling. ERP should remain the system of record for core transactions, controls, and master data domains that require enterprise consistency. Surrounding retail applications such as ecommerce, warehouse systems, planning tools, or point of sale should integrate through an API-first strategy with explicit ownership of events, data contracts, and error handling. Identity and Access Management should be designed early to support segregation of duties, role-based access, and auditability across corporate and field users.
For cloud deployments, architecture governance should also define environment strategy, observability, backup and recovery expectations, and release management controls. Cloud-native components, managed databases such as PostgreSQL, containerized services using Docker or Kubernetes, and monitoring platforms may be relevant when the implementation includes extensions or integration services. They should be introduced only where they simplify operations, improve scalability, or reduce deployment friction.
What is the right implementation roadmap for merchandising and supply coordination?
The right roadmap sequences business capability, not just modules. Most retail organizations benefit from a phased approach that stabilizes foundational data and transaction controls before layering advanced planning or automation. Early phases typically focus on item and supplier master data, purchasing, inventory visibility, receiving, and financial integration. Subsequent phases can address allocation, replenishment optimization, omnichannel coordination, workflow automation, and analytics. A roadmap should also reflect seasonal constraints, peak trading periods, and warehouse blackout windows.
| Roadmap Phase | Primary Objective |
|---|---|
| Foundation | Establish governance, master data standards, core process design, and integration baseline |
| Build and Validate | Configure workflows, complete integrations, migrate data, and execute role-based testing |
| Readiness and Cutover | Train users, rehearse cutover, confirm support model, and validate business continuity |
| Stabilization and Optimize | Resolve defects, monitor KPIs, refine workflows, and prioritize enhancement backlog |
How should data migration and integration governance be handled?
They should be governed as business risk domains, not technical workstreams alone. In retail, poor item, supplier, location, cost, and inventory data can undermine purchasing, replenishment, pricing, and reporting from day one. Governance should assign data owners by domain, define quality thresholds, approve transformation rules, and require multiple rehearsal cycles. Teams should decide early which historical data is operationally necessary, which can remain in legacy archives, and which should be cleansed before migration.
Integration governance should define source-of-truth rules, message timing, failure handling, and reconciliation controls. This is especially important where ERP must coordinate with ecommerce, warehouse management, transportation, supplier portals, or analytics platforms. A common mistake is to test interfaces for technical success without validating business outcomes such as inventory accuracy, order status consistency, or financial posting completeness.
How do change management, training, and user adoption affect governance success?
They determine whether governance decisions become operational reality. Retail ERP programs often fail not because the design is wrong, but because users continue to work around the system. Change management should begin during discovery by identifying role impacts, decision changes, and control changes for merchants, buyers, planners, allocators, warehouse teams, store operations, and finance users. Training should be role-based, scenario-driven, and timed close enough to go-live that knowledge is retained.
Adoption improves when governance includes business champions, super users, and clear escalation paths for process exceptions. Implementation leaders should measure readiness through task completion, confidence levels, and process simulation results rather than attendance alone. What should operational readiness and go-live planning include?
Operational readiness should confirm that the business can run safely on the new platform, not merely that testing is complete. Readiness criteria should cover support staffing, issue triage, cutover ownership, inventory reconciliation, supplier communication, access provisioning, reporting availability, and fallback procedures. Go-live planning should include a detailed cutover runbook, command center structure, decision thresholds, and business continuity controls for stores, distribution, and digital channels.
- Validate critical day-one scenarios such as item setup, purchase order release, receiving, stock updates, and financial posting
- Rehearse cutover with realistic timing, dependency checks, and named business owners for each task
- Define hypercare metrics for transaction volume, defect severity, inventory accuracy, and user support response
What common mistakes weaken retail ERP governance?
The most common mistakes are governance by meeting volume, unclear decision rights, and late business ownership. Programs also struggle when they treat merchandising and supply as separate transformations, over-customize to preserve legacy exceptions, or postpone data quality work until testing. Another frequent issue is underestimating the operational impact of role changes, especially where buyers, planners, and store teams must adopt new approval paths or exception workflows. Governance weakens further when executive sponsors receive status updates but are not asked to resolve policy conflicts.
A more subtle mistake is optimizing for implementation speed at the expense of supportability. Fast builds can create brittle integrations, unclear ownership, and weak controls that increase post-go-live cost. Strong governance accepts that some decisions require more time because they shape long-term operating discipline.
How should executives evaluate trade-offs, ROI, and partner strategy?
Executives should evaluate trade-offs through a business capability lens. Standardization usually lowers support cost and improves control, but it may reduce local flexibility. Phased delivery reduces risk, but it can extend the period of hybrid operations. Deep customization may preserve familiar workflows, but it often increases testing effort, upgrade friction, and dependency on specialist resources. ROI should therefore be assessed across inventory productivity, process cycle time, margin protection, reporting reliability, and reduced manual reconciliation rather than software deployment alone.

What future trends should retail leaders prepare for?
Retail governance is moving toward more continuous, data-led operating models. AI-assisted implementation can help analyze process variants, identify data anomalies, and accelerate test case generation, but it does not replace business decision ownership. Workflow automation will continue to improve exception routing, supplier collaboration, and approval efficiency. More retailers will also expect real-time integration patterns, stronger observability, and tighter alignment between ERP, commerce, and fulfillment platforms. As these capabilities expand, governance will become even more important because the cost of poor master data and unclear ownership rises with automation.
